History and Origins of Dance
Dance, an ancient performing art, has existed throughout human history. From primitive dances associated with rituals and beliefs to sophisticated court dances, dance has always reflected the culture, society, and soul of humanity. Each civilization has its own unique forms of dance, expressed through characteristic movements, costumes, and music. Let’s explore famous classical dance forms around the world such as Ballet, Vietnamese Folk Dance, Spanish Flamenco, Belly Dance, etc… Each dance carries a story, a unique cultural value that needs to be preserved and developed.
Popular Dance Types Around the World
Ballet:
Ballet, considered the queen of dance forms, is famous for its skillful techniques, gracefulness, and subtle expressions. From light jumps to complex movements requiring years of training, ballet always captivates viewers with its elegance and charm.
Folk Dance:
Folk dance is an extremely rich art treasure, reflecting the life, customs, and traditions of each ethnic group. Each folk dance has its own meaning, telling stories, legends, or expressing people’s feelings and thoughts.
Modern Dance:
Modern dance emerged as a departure, a revolution compared to traditional dance forms. The freedom of expression, the combination of different techniques, modern dance reflects the artist’s freedom, modernity, and creativity.
Current Dance Development Trends
In the present day, dance is not only a purely performing art but is also combined with many other fields such as cinema, music, and fashion. The emergence of dance reality TV shows and the rapid development of social media have helped promote and popularize dance art to the public. In addition, the combination of dance and technology such as light dance and 3D dance is increasingly popular and promises to create many new breakthroughs in the future.
The Importance of Dance to Society
Dance is not only a form of entertainment but also carries many profound educational and social values. Dance helps people improve their health, increase flexibility, and dexterity. Dance is also a means to express feelings, cultural exchange, and promote understanding and connection between communities.
